Mastering useAction, useFormStatus, and Server Actions in Next.js 15+ (Full Guide for App Router)

Опубликовано: 21 Ноябрь 2024
на канале: awebcode
31
4

Ready to level up your Next.js skills? 🚀 This tutorial dives deep into useAction, formState, and server actions in the App Router of Next.js 13 and beyond. Whether you're building a simple form or working on advanced server-side logic, this guide has you covered!

In this video, you'll learn:
✅ What useAction is and how to manage client-side state seamlessly
✅ Handling form states like a pro with real-world examples
✅ How to leverage Server Actions for secure and efficient server-side logic
✅ Best practices for integrating these features into your Next.js projects

💡 Practical Use Cases Covered:
✨ Simple form submission with client and server-side validation
✨ File uploads and progress tracking with useAction
✨ Optimizing server actions for database writes and API calls

💻 Chapters:
0:00 - Introduction to Server Actions in Next.js
3:00 - Why useAction is a Game-Changer
7:30 - Managing Form States with formState
8:00 - Building Secure and Efficient Server Actions
9:00 - Integrating with Database and APIs
10:00 - Common Pitfalls and Best Practices

This tutorial is beginner-friendly but packed with tips for experienced developers too!

🔥 Subscribe to learn more about Next.js, React, and cutting-edge web development techniques. Let us know in the comments: What do you want to learn next about Next.js?